Hiring an HVAC (Heating, Ventilation, and Air Conditioning) contractor is an important decision as they will be responsible for installing, maintaining, and repairing your HVAC system, which plays a crucial role in keeping your home comfortable and energy-efficient. Here are some things to consider while hiring an HVAC contractor:

Licensing and certifications: Check if the contractor is licensed to work in your state and has the required certifications for the type of work you need. This ensures that they have the necessary skills and training to handle your HVAC system.

Experience and reputation: Look for contractors with several years of experience in the industry and a good reputation for quality workmanship and customer service. You can ask for references or check online reviews to gauge their reputation.

Insurance and warranties: Ensure that the contractor has liability insurance to cover any damages that may occur during the installation or repair work. Also, check if they offer warranties on their work, parts, and equipment.

Cost and estimates: Get multiple quotes from different contractors and compare them. However, keep in mind that the cheapest option may not always be the best one, and quality should be the top priority.

Energy efficiency and sustainability: Consider hiring a contractor who is knowledgeable about energy-efficient and sustainable HVAC systems. They can help you choose the right equipment and provide advice on reducing energy consumption and environmental impact.

Communication and professionalism: Look for contractors who are easy to communicate with, responsive to your queries, and maintain a professional demeanor throughout the hiring process.
